Speculative Grammar and Stoic Language Theory in Medieval Allegorical Narrative

Discover the profound insights of "Speculative Grammar and Stoic Language Theory in Medieval Allegorical Narrative" by Jeffr Bardzell and Jeffrey Bardzell, published by Taylor & Francis Ltd in 2008. This captivating 146-page study challenges traditional perspectives by revealing how signification in medieval allegorical narratives is rooted not in Aristotelian language theories, but in a distinctive Stoic approach that influenced grammar theory throughout the Middle Ages. Delve into the intricate interplay between ethics and literature as the authors explore how this alternative language framework shaped the narratives of renowned figures such as Prudentius and Alanus de Insulis. Ideal for scholars and enthusiasts of Latin literature and medieval history, this hardback book invites readers to rethink the foundations of medieval allegory.
